Understanding the Threat Landscape
What a Catfish Looks Like
A catfish is a fake identity created to deceive. The profile may feature professional‑grade photos, an alluring bio, and promises of fast romance. Common red flags include:
- Too‑good‑to‑be‑true looks – glossy studio shots that seem unrelated to everyday life.
- Vague personal details – missing work history, education, or hometown.
- Rapid emotional escalation – “I feel a strong connection already” after a few messages.
Typical Scam Tactics
Scammers often follow a predictable script:
- Establish trust – share personal stories, ask about your day.
- Create urgency – claim a sudden emergency or a business opportunity.
- Ask for money or personal info – request wire transfers, gift cards, or passwords.
Understanding these patterns helps you spot deception before it escalates.

Building a Scam‑Resistant Profile
1. Use Authentic Photos
Choose clear, recent images that show your face and a few everyday activities. Avoid heavily edited or stock pictures. Real photos make it harder for fraudsters to impersonate you.
2. Share Verifiable Details
Mention your city, occupation, and hobbies in a way that can be cross‑checked later. If you list a favorite coffee shop, you can later suggest meeting there—a natural safety check.
3. Set Boundaries Early
State in your bio that you prefer video chats before sharing phone numbers. This signals that you value safety and discourages scammers who rely on quick personal contact.

Spotting Red Flags in Conversations
When you receive a message, run a quick mental checklist:
- Grammar and tone – Many scammers use generic, poorly phrased English.
- Requests for personal data – Legitimate matches won’t ask for your address or banking info.
- Inconsistent stories – If their work schedule or location changes without explanation, be cautious.
Quick Verification Steps
- Reverse‑image search – Upload their profile picture to a free service like Google Images. If the same photo appears on unrelated sites, it may be stolen.
- Check social media – A genuine person usually has a consistent online presence.
- Ask specific questions – Inquire about details only a real person could answer (e.g., “What’s the name of the park you jog in?”).

Advanced Techniques for the Seasoned Dater
Even experienced users can sharpen their defenses. Try these expert strategies:
- Pattern analysis – Keep a log of recurring phrases or requests from different users. Scammers often reuse scripts.
- Two‑factor authentication (2FA) – Enable 2FA on your dating account to prevent unauthorized logins.
- Secure payment methods – If you ever need to purchase premium features, use a credit card with fraud protection rather than direct bank transfers.
